The Modus Operandi HDPrimeHub operates primarily through a network of domains. To evade government bans and ISP blocks, the site frequently changes its domain extensions (e.g., .com, .in, .net, .org). Legal and Ethical Implications The operation of HDPrimeHub is illegal under copyright laws in most jurisdictions. By distributing content without the permission of the original creators and production houses, the platform causes significant financial loss to the entertainment industry.
The Impact on the Industry Platforms like HDPrimeHub undermine the revenue model of the film industry. While production houses invest millions in creating content, piracy sites leak this content for free, discouraging audiences from purchasing cinema tickets or subscribing to legal streaming services.
